Physical characteristics of the surface that influence interactions between spheres — roughness, permeability, and resistance properties. The surface as a boundary condition for hydrological and atmospheric models.

Scope

  • Surface roughness: Aerodynamic roughness length (z₀) for wind modelling, hydraulic roughness for overland flow
  • Aerodynamic resistance: Resistance to turbulent heat/moisture exchange
  • Infiltration capacity: As a surface interface property (soil-specific infiltration is Soil Properties)
  • Impervious surface: Fraction of sealed/paved ground
